Big changes could be in store for Georgia-Florida game. The World’s Largest Outdoor Cocktail Party may become the World’s Largest Outdoor Cocktail Festival.
“We have to take the Georgia-Florida game and turn it into something that resembles a National Championship game,” Gator Bowl Sports President and CEO Rick Catlett told 1010XL Jax Sports Radio. “The events that go on around Georgia-Florida need to significantly be enhanced. It’s a nice tailgate party in the pavilion area, but it needs to be all down the river.”
Gator Bowl Sports serves as the umbrella company which organizes and manages the Georgia-Florida game. Catlett’s vision for the game extends beyond a one-day event.
“You’ve got to create a three or four day festival around it. Friday all day you’re going to have to have special events going on. When you go to the NFL Experience (at the Super Bowl) it’s not just a tailgate party. It gives people an opportunity to go to the facility, touch the game, touch the sport, but it also gives all the people coming in from out of town major entertainment, parties, events,” he said.
